Beverage filling machines are integral components in the packaging sector, particularly for businesses looking to optimize their bottling operations. An 8000 bph (bottles per hour) beverage filling machine represents a specific category within this domain, designed to cater to medium to large-scale production demands. This category is characterized by its capacity to efficiently fill 8000 bottles per hour, striking a balance between speed and precision in the filling process.
The application of an 8000 bph beverage filling machine spans various industries, including food and beverages, pharmaceuticals, and chemicals. Depending on the substance being filled, there are several types of machines available. Liquid filling machines are commonly used for water, juices, and other beverages, while powder filling machines handle products like sugar and spices. For businesses dealing with capsules, specialized capsule filling machines are essential. The choice of machine will depend on the product's viscosity, with positive displacement pump fillers being ideal for thicker substances like creams and gels.
An 8000 bph beverage filling machine is engineered to enhance efficiency. These machines come in manual, semi-automatic, and fully automatic variants. Manual fillers are suitable for smaller operations, whereas semi-automatic and fully automatic machines meet the needs of larger production lines. Features such as precision filling, speed control, and user-friendly interfaces are inherent to these machines, ensuring a seamless production flow.
The construction of an 8000 bph beverage filling machine typically involves robust materials like stainless steel, which offers durability and compliance with food safety standards. The design of these machines also takes into account ease of cleaning and maintenance, ensuring longevity and consistent performance.
Selecting the right 8000 bph beverage filling machine requires an understanding of your specific production needs. Factors such as the type of liquid or powder, bottle size and shape, and the desired level of automation play a crucial role in this decision. It's important to assess the compatibility of the machine with your existing production line to ensure a smooth integration.
Automation in filling processes, as offered by an 8000 bph beverage filling machine, presents numerous advantages. It significantly reduces the time and labor involved in manual filling, minimizes errors, and ensures a consistent product output. By streamlining operations, businesses can achieve a higher throughput, which is critical for meeting market demands and maintaining competitiveness.
